### **Practice Questions**

#### 1. **Positive / Negative / Zero Checker**

Write a Python program that takes a number as input and checks whether it is **positive**, **negative**, or **zero**.


#### 2. **Odd or Even**

Write a Python program to check whether a number is **even** or **odd**.


#### 3. **Age Eligibility for Voting**

Write a program to take a person’s age as input and check if they are **eligible to vote** (18 years or older).


#### 4. **Largest of Two Numbers**

Write a Python program that takes two numbers as input and prints the **larger number** using conditional statements.


#### 5. **Largest of Three Numbers**

Write a Python program to find the **largest among three numbers** entered by the user using `if`, `elif`, and `else`.


#### 6. **Grading System**

Write a Python program to take a student's marks as input and print the **grade** according to the following criteria:

* Marks ≥ 90 → Grade A
* Marks ≥ 75 and < 90 → Grade B
* Marks ≥ 50 and < 75 → Grade C
* Marks < 50 → Grade F


#### 7. **Leap Year Checker**

Write a program to check whether a given year is a **leap year** or not.
*(Hint: A year is leap if divisible by 4 but not 100, or divisible by 400)*


#### 8. **Nested If — Number Range Checker**

Write a program that takes a number as input and:

* Checks if it's **positive**.
* If positive, further checks if it is **less than 10**, **between 10 and 50**, or **greater than 50**.


#### 9. **Character Classification**

Write a program to input a single character and check whether it is:

* a **vowel**,
* a **consonant**,
* a **digit**, or
* a **special character**.


#### 10. **Login Authentication (Simple)**

Write a program that asks the user to enter a **username** and **password**.

* If the username is `"admin"` and the password is `"12345"`, print **“Login Successful”**.
* Otherwise, print **“Invalid credentials”**.
